FIELD: metallurgy.
SUBSTANCE: invention relates to metallurgy, namely to sintered nitrogen-containing alloys based on chromium. It can be used in metallurgy for joint alloying of steel with chromium and nitrogen. Sintered nitrided ferrochrome contains, wt.%: nitrogen 8.0-18.0, iron 11.0-26.0, aluminium not more than 0.5, silicon not more than 1.5, carbon not more than 0.1, oxygen not more than 1.0, chromium is a base. Density of alloy is from 3.5 to 5.8 g/cm3, and porosity is from 19 to 49 vol.%.
EFFECT: obtaining nitrided ferrochrome, which enables to melt high-nitrogen steels at minimum consumption of alloy with maximum degree of nitrogen assimilation by melt.
